to topic: I watched the series a while ago and actually I liked it a lot better than Air and Kanon together. The different stories and scene changes were very interessting and the overall anime was very beautiful in its own way. I loved for example how the makers played with different colours and special effects, while they tell the different stories.

[spoiler]For example episode where Renji is denying to kiss her at the beach even though her "girlfriend" asks him to do so and the following break down of him was very perfectly done. The color play and the special effects fit really well to the anime and make it very unique. That's why I totally love ef \(^.^)/[/spoiler]
